Through our programs of teaching and research, and our service to the community, we advance the knowledge and application of physical activity to promote the health and well-being of all people.
|
Scientific Foundations of Physical Activity
- Explain how the scientific process informs our understanding of physical activity
- Describe the underlying scientific foundations of physical activity
- Critically evaluate information about physical activity from a scientific basis
Physical Activity in Health, Wellness and Quality of Life
- Describe the relationship between physical activity participation and health, wellness and quality of life
- Critically evaluate research related to physical activity and its impact on health and chronic disease
- Design and evaluate physical activity programs that promote health and improve quality of life
Cultural, Historical, and Philosophical Dimensions of Physical Activity
- Describe the sociocultural and historical factors that influence physical activity
- Demonstrate an appreciation of cultural diversity and make ethical decisions
- Critically evaluate scholarly work related to cultural, historical, and philosophical dimensions of physical activity
The Practice of Physical Activity
- Demonstrate an appreciation and commitment to physical activity practice
